Hall Matron Argenta (Japanese: ステージマドンナ ケイト Stage Madonna Kate) is the Frontier Brain in charge of running the Battle Frontier's Battle Hall. She is the only character in the games to have the Trainer class Hall Matron (Japanese: ステージマドンナ Stage Madonna).

In the games

Argenta is the Frontier Brain of the Battle Hall in the Sinnoh and Johto regions. She can be challenged after 50 consecutive battles, which is unique as all other Frontier Brains can be challenged after 21 consecutive battles. Once defeated, she will give away the silver commemorative print. Argenta can be challenged again after 170 consecutive battles, and will give away the gold commemorative print when defeated. The player must defeat all types at least 10 times before challenging her again and again.

In the manga

In the Pokémon Adventures manga

Argenta and Thorton in Pokémon Adventures

Argenta first appears along with her fellow Frontier Brains, Palmer, Dahlia, and Thorton in a meeting; afterward they go back to their facilities. Argenta, along with Palmer, is seen trying to investigate the communication system of the Battle Frontier going down. After Thorton is defeated by Platinum, she slaps him out of the temper tantrum he was throwing.

Later, at the Battle Hall, Argenta faces Platinum in the final match. Her Dragonite proved powerful but was eventually defeated by Platinum's Froslass.

Argenta's Dragonite
Dragonite
Argenta's Dragonite was used to battle Platinum at the Battle Hall. It proved powerful and was able to deal heavy damage to Platinum's Froslass despite the type disadvantage. Eventually, it was defeated by a super effective Ice Shard, making Platinum the winner of the match.

Dragonite's only known move is Steel Wing.

Names

Language Name Origin
Japanese ケイトKate From 鶏頭 keitō, plumed cockscomb
English, German, Spanish Argenta From Celosia argentea, the scientific name of the plumed cockscomb. May also be derived from argentum, Latin for silver.
French Célosia From Celosia
Italian Mara Possibly from Amaranthaceae, the family where the plumed cockscomb belongs to
Korean 맨드라 Mandra From Mandrake.
Chinese (Mandarin) 凱特 Kǎitè Transliteration of Kate
